A statistics student wants to predict the annual salaries of employees at one large company. He wants to know if he can use the number of years that someone has worked at the company to predict his or her annual salary.

What is the explanatory variable in this scenario?

A) The statistics student

B) Number of years that someone has worked at the company

C) Employees of the company

D) Annual salary
